Transaction 166d30b901745ac95f6cf13e6932302fa5b497490a7507de98c9834c91fcc9b2
1 Input
1 Output
-
166d30b901745ac95f6cf13e6932302fa5b497490a7507de98c9834c91fcc9b2:0
- value
- 93726
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d8880baa2c9a96240dbd080346aa79307f4c496e092dfae13f96536a19158a29
- address
- bc1pmzyqh23vn2tzgrdapqp5d2nexpl5cjtwpykl4cfljefk5xg43g5sz9pzv4